How much do computer analyst j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for computer analyst in Kentucky is $29.58,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$21.73 and $34.47 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Computer Anal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Computer Analyst, you need strong analytical skills, a solid understanding of information systems, and typically a bachelor’s deg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with database management systems, programming languages, and enterprise software, along with certifications like CompTIA or Microsoft, is often required. Probl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for this role. These skills ensure the efficient analysis, optimization, and support of technology systems that drive organizational success.

What are some common challenges Computer Analysts face when integrating new technologies into existing systems?

Computer Analysts often encounter challenges such as ensuring compatibility between new and legacy systems, minimizing disruptions during the transition, and addressing security concerns that may arise with new integrations. Effective communication with stakeholders and thorough testing are essential to identify potential issues early. Additionally, staying updated on the latest technological advancements and best practices helps analysts recommend solutions that align with organizational goals.

Is SOC an entry level job?

A Security Operations Center (SOC) analyst is typically an entry-level to mid-level cybersecurity role that involves monitoring and analyzing security threats using tools like SIEM systems. While some positions may require prior experience or certifications such as CompTIA Security+ or Cisco CCNA, many organizations offer entry-level opportunities for candidates with foundational IT knowledge and strong analytical skills.

What are computer analysts?

Computer analysts, also known as computer systems analysts, are professionals who study an organization’s current computer systems and procedures, then design solutions to help the organization operate more efficiently and effectively. They bridge the gap between business needs and technology solutions by analyzing problems, recommending improvements, and sometimes overseeing the implementation of new systems. Their role often involves both technical and business aspects, such as evaluating new IT technologies, optimizing system performance, and ensuring that IT solutions align with organizational goals.

What does a computer analyst do?

A computer analyst evaluates an organization’s computer systems and recommends improvements to enhance efficiency and security. They analyze hardware, software, and network performance, often using tools like diagnostic software, and may develop or implement new systems. Strong problem-solving skills and knowledge of programming, databases, and cybersecurity are essential for this role.
